Coinbase has built the world's leading compliant cryptocurrency platform serving over 30 million accounts in more than 100 countries. With multiple successful products, and our vocal advocacy for blockchain technology, we have played a major part in mainstream awareness and adoption of cryptocurrency. We are proud to offer an entire suite of products that are helping build the cryptoeconomy and increase economic freedom around the world.

There are a few things we look for across all hires we make at Coinbase, regardless of role or team. First, we look for signals that a candidate will thrive in a culture like ours, where we default to trust, embrace feedback, disrupt ourselves, and expect sustained high performance because we play as a championship team. Second, we expect all employees to commit to our mission-focused approach to our work. Finally, we seek people with the desire and capacity to build and share expertise in the frontier technologies of crypto and blockchain, in whatever way is most relevant to their role.

To strengthen our growing Enterprise Applications & Architecture (EAA) team, we are looking for an experienced Director, Enterprise Product Mgt & Engineering (CX, Product BUs), passionate about redefining technology into critical business value. You will synthesize a product vision and partner with Business Units to lead engineering teams to build, launch, and scale business processes. You will report to the Sr. Director of Enterprise Applications and Architecture, and be part of the larger Coinbase Customer Experience Organization.

What you’ll be doing (ie. job duties):

Product management:

  • Run ideation and demand for multiple Business Units: CX (Customer Experience), Product (Customer Product & Engineering), and dependencies with Compliance and Coverage
  • Build strong relationships with various levels of stakeholders across the company
  • Effectively communicate with all levels of staff, including executive level stakeholders
  • Prioritize and maintain BU backlogs and cross-BU interdependencies
  • Convey product vision through bold product roadmaps and proactively plan future capabilities, working closely with key SAAS platform vendors - Salesforce, Tethr/Qualtrics, Live Person Messaging Platform, Adobe Experience Manager (AEM)/Contentful
  • Lead 2-4 Product Managers to deliver high quality PRDs, roadmaps, backlogs
  • Understand Bus Ops work and shield Engineering from noise and changes in priority
  • Capture and influence business team’s vision and requirements
  • Ensure Engineering teams have 4-6 weeks worth of refined backlog in each area
  • Present Demos to business units of capabilities completed
  • Ensure PMs sign off on completed work in a timely manner
  • Ensure PMs document and drive successful Business Sign-off or User Acceptance Testing (UAT) with BUs
  • Identify and resolve inefficiencies in PM tools, process, and workflows as well as brainstorming new methods of efficiency to support our key business partners
  • Articulate build or buy recommendations for key capabilities, required to deliver various aspects of the product solution
  • Articulate competitive advantage vs infrastructure and scalability capabilities
  • Define and analyze metrics that mature the Product Management function

ENGINEERING:

Lead engineering work on platforms for multiple Business Units:

  • CX (Salesforce Service Cloud, Chatbots, Customer Communities, Adobe Experience Manager (AEM)/Contentful for help.com,Tethr/Qualtrics, LivePerson)
  • Product & Engineering (Salesforce Customer Communities for Institutional onboarding, Custody Billing)
  • Dependencies with other BUs:
  • Compliance (Salesforce Service Cloud, Refinitiv)
  • Coverage (Salesforce Sales Cloud)
  • Operate in a Plan-Buy/Configure/Integrate-Run model
  • Prioritize and maintain engineering work and cross-BU interdependencies
  • Convey engineering vision through bold, scalable architecture and proactively plan future capabilities, working closely with key SAAS platform vendors
  • Lead a team of 2-3 Engineering Managers with 2-6 engineers in each team, to deliver high quality results
  • Identify and resolve inefficiencies in Engineering tools, process, and workflows as well as brainstorming new methods of efficiency to support our key business partners
  • Articulate build or buy recommendations for key capabilities, required to deliver various aspects of the product solution
  • Articulate competitive advantage vs infrastructure and scalability capabilities
  • Define and analyze metrics that mature the Engineering function
  • Ensure engineers spend 10-20% of their backlogs on Non-functional requirements, automation of CI/CD pipelines, automation of testing, and Technical Debt Management
  • Ensure Engineering teams have 4-6 weeks worth of refined backlog in each area

What we look for in you (ie. job requirements):

  • BA/BS in Engineering, Computer Sciences desired
  • 10+ years experience in Product Mgt and Engineering, including custom and packaged apps and platforms
  • Experience working with the Customer Experience (CX) technology stack:
  • Salesforce (Service Cloud, Sales Cloud, Customer Communities)
  • Chatbot (ADA, LivePerson or other, we are doing an RFP)
  • Qualtrics/Tethr
  • Adobe Experience Manager/Contentful (our help.com)
  • Experience with Automation of testing and CI/CD for above platforms
  • People Management experience in a fast-paced environment
  • Experience leading uncertainty and changing requirements in a high-growth, startup environment
  • Background working with Agile sprints, backlogs in Jira
  • Experience with Docker, Github, PagerDuty
  • Background in non-functional requirements like scalability, automation testing, and security
  • Experience with vendor management is a plus

Nice to haves:

  • Experience in the Financial industry
  • Experience with Snowflake, Looker, or equivalent applications
  • Lean Six Sigma background
  • Passionate about the crypto economy and DeFi
